Meaning & usage
a ride on a mount (animal) or man-powered vehicle
a drive in an animal-drawn or motorized vehicle
a stage or lap as part of a long tour or journey
Where this word comes from
From Middle Dutch *rit, in Middle Dutch only sparsely attested in compounds, from Middle Low German rit or Middle High German ritt, related to Middle Dutch rêde, dialectal Dutch reed, ultimately from Proto-West Germanic *rīdan.
